This review is from: Audio Systems Design and Installation (Paperback)
What's interesting about this book is that it covers aspects related to audio installations that is not normally covered in audio related books.It deals practical installation issues such as AC power (e.g. regulation), grounding, earthing, interconnection, connectors, cable, wire termination and racking. It is really a reference book for installers, not a book that you would read from start to finish. The information is a bit obscure so the book is not all that useful for those without a strong engineering background.

This review is from: Audio Systems Design and Installation (Paperback)
This is the bible of audio interfacing. I truly could not get along without this book. It is written in a clear and concise manner and is well indexed. It truly covers just about every scenario. The only source that is required beyond this book for information on the studio interconnect jungle is a copy of the local Electrical Code. This due to the reality that what is best for the interconnecting and powering of an audio production facility is sometimes frowned upon by local codes. If you check most other reference materials on this subject this text will be in the bibliography. It is somewhat technical in nature so it is not for the laymen.
